> bridge: Partially disable netpoll support
> 
> The new netpoll code in bridging contains use-after-free bugs
> that are non-trivial to fix.
> 
> This patch fixes this by removing the code that uses skbs after
> they're freed.
> 
> As a consequence, this means that we can no longer call bridge
> from the netpoll path, so this patch also removes the controller
> function in order to disable netpoll.
